What causes bad alignment in my 2019 Toyota 4Runner?
There are many factors that can cause your wheels to become misaligned.
- Alterations of your suspension must be made if you change the height of your vehicle otherwise your vehicle will be misaligned.
- Speed bumps, potholes, and contact with other road hazards are the most noted reasons for the wheels of your 2019 Toyota 4Runner to misalign.
- Wear and tear on your vehicle's suspension components will cause your 2019 Toyota 4Runner to become misaligned.
- Even the most minor of vehicle accidents and impacts can vary the alignment of your 2019 Toyota 4Runner.
What are common symptoms that my 2019 Toyota 4Runner needs an alignment?
The following are the most common signs that your 2019 Toyota 4Runner needs an alignment.
- If you are holding your steering wheel straight, yet your 2019 Toyota 4Runner is pulling to the right or left then you need an alignment.
- Uneven wear and tear of your tire tread means your 2019 Toyota 4Runner has an alignment issue.
- If your 2019 Toyota 4Runner has noisy steering then it's relevant you need an alignment. There are multiple reasons your steering may be making that sound, so bring it in and have the professionals audit your vehicle's issue.
- If your steering wheel is crooked or pointed to the left or right when you are driving straight, then your 2019 Toyota 4Runner needs an alignment quickly.

Why is an alignment important for my 2019 Toyota 4Runner
If your vehicle becomes misaligned you'll notice your steering & handling may become troublesome to manage and the performance of your 2019 Toyota 4Runner will certainly be noticeably worse than familiar. Driving straight will become laborious, braking may prove to be serious or skip, fuel efficiency will diminish and your tires will degrade much faster than daily. In the end, it will rate you more money the longer you put off having your alignment completed.
